阳光网驿-企业信息化交流平台【DTC零售连锁全渠道解决方案】

 找回密码
 注册

QQ登录

只需一步,快速开始

扫描二维码登录本站

手机号码,快捷登录

老司机
查看: 8868|回复: 16

[转帖] [教程] 图文并茂 在MyEclipse 8.6上搭建Android开发环境

  [复制链接]
  • TA的每日心情
    开心
    2021-8-30 00:00
  • 签到天数: 35 天

    [LV.5]常住居民I

    发表于 2011-10-26 11:55:48 | 显示全部楼层 |阅读模式

    ,基本环境准备:
    安装JDK1.5以上,Eclipse3.3以上版本.(MyEclipse也可以),笔者安装了JDK1.6和MyEclipse 8.6。

    JDK1.6
    1035281.jpg
    MyEclipse 8.6
    2,下载Android SDK
    可能需要翻墙,当然翻墙的方法很多,我这里也不能说了,如果你实在没有找到方法,
    可以加QQ 2030988 和我交流。
    地址:http://developer.android.com/sdk/index.html
    下载成功后:

    1035282.png
    Android SDK文件
    解压到某目录下:
    1035283.png
    解压文件
    1035284.png
    解压目录
    双击SDK Setup.exe 安装SDK,安装完成后,文件夹入下图所示:
    1035285.png
    安装SDK
    3,配置SDK环境变量:
    主要是在path 中加入SDK 下的tools目录:
    1035286.png
    在path 中加入SDK 下的tools目录
    环境变量:
    1035287.png
    环境变量
    完成以后SDK就算配置完成。

    4,给MyEclipse安装ADT插件
    打开eclipse的help菜单->MyEclipse Configuration Center
    1035288.png
    打开eclipse的help菜单
    进入后点击 Software 标签
    1035289.png
    Software 标签
    在Browser Software后面的 add site
    10352810.png
    Browser Software
    在对话框中填写如图所示:(name 自己取)
    10352811.png
    在对话框中填写名称后点击ok
    然后在左边会出现 如
    10352812.png

    点击Add to Profile选中目标,右键点击Add to Profile,于是在右边的Software Updates Available 就会有所反应,
    10352813.png
    Software Updates Available
    然后点击下面的Apply 2 changes 来开始安装
    10352814.png
    点击下面的Apply 2 changes
    10352815.png
    开始安装
    点击接受下面的许可,继续。
    10352816.png
    点击接受
    接着点击Update开始安装。这个过程可能有点慢,耐心等待他的完成。
    10352817.png
    Update开始安装
    5,配置MyEclipse

    点击window –>preferences
    10352818.png
    点击window –>preferences
    在Android选项,填写好SDK location,点击Apply后出现以下内容。
    10352819.png
    点击Apply后出现的内容

    6,AVD的管理
    点击window-> Android SDK and AVD Manager
    10352820.png
    Android SDK and AVD Manager
    然后选择 Available Package
    因为需要兼容性测试,如果条件允许,最好 多装些版本。
    然后,点击Install Selected 开始安装。这又是一个漫长的过程,可能非常漫长。呵呵
    安装好了后。我们开始建立一个虚拟机
    10352821.png
    点击new

    10352822.png
    创建
    创建成功后,可以启动试试
    10352823.png
    启动,点击Start
    10352824.png
    开始启动模拟器
    点击Start ,然后点击launch,开始启动模拟器。
    7,创建Hello World程序
    创建一个Android 项目
    10352825.png
    点击next

    10352826.png
    点击NEXT

    右键点击项目->Run As –> Android Application
    10352827.png
    点击右键
    即可看到效果:
    10352828.png
    搭建成功
    现在,你可以开始研究这个Hello Word 程序了,祝你好运。谢谢


    该贴已经同步到 sunwy的微博
    楼主热帖
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2021-8-30 00:00
  • 签到天数: 35 天

    [LV.5]常住居民I

     楼主| 发表于 2011-10-26 20:54:18 | 显示全部楼层
    Sunwy注:看到正面这个文字版本的更详细,也转了

    要想编写Android应用,首先需要搭建Android 的开发环境,相比于其他智能机系统,Android的环境还是很友好的。下面我就分步骤讲一下如何搭建开发环境。
    1、下载必要软件
    需要下载的程式有:
    (1)Java SDK(java运行环境和java开发包)
    http://cds.sun.com/is-bin/INTERSHOP.enfinity/WFS/CDS-CDS_Developer-Site/en_US/-/USD/VerifyItem-Start/jdk-6u24-windows-i586.exe?BundledLineItemUUID=67CJ_hCyACAAAAEuvycIR1.x&OrderID=ZKiJ_hCyGUcAAAEusycIR1.x&ProductID=riyJ_hCwfJMAAAEt9MkADqmS&FileName=/jdk-6u24-windows-i586.exe
    (2)Eclipse或者是MyEclipse的最新版本(程式编写与调试环境)
    http://www.eclipse.org/downloads/
    (3)Android SDK Manager(用于下载和管理Android开发包)
    http://dl.google.com/android/android-sdk_r08-windows.zip
    (4)ADT Plugin for Eclipse(用于在Eclipse或者MyEclipse中建立Android项目)
    http://dl.google.com/android/ADT-10.0.0.zip
    2、软件安装
    (1)首先安装Java SDK,安装包是傻瓜式的,具体安装步骤就不赘述了。
    设置环境变量步骤如下:


    • 我的电脑->属性->高级->环境变量->系统变量中添加以下环境变量:
    • JAVA_HOME值为: D:Program FilesJavajdk1.6.0_18(你安装JDK的目录
    • CLASSPATH值为:.;%JAVA_HOME%lib ools.jar;%JAVA_HOME%libdt.jar;%JAVA_HOME%in;
    • Path: 在开始追加 %JAVA_HOME%in;
    • NOTE:前面四步设置环境变量对搭建Android开发环境不是必须的,可以跳过。
    安装完成之后,可以在检查JDK是否安装成功。打开cmd窗口,输入java –version 查看JDK的版本信息。出现类似下面的画面表示安装成功了:
    image_thumb_2.png

    (2)Eclipse或者是MyEclipse按需求安装
    解压之后即可使用。
    (3)


    • 运行SDK Setup.exe,点击Available Packages。如果没有出现可安装的包,请点击Settings,选中Misc中的"Force https://..."这项,再点击Available Packages 。
    • 选择希望安装的SDK及其文档或者其它包,点击Installation Selected、Accept All、Install Accepted,开始下载安装所选包
    • 在用户变量中新建PATH值为:Android SDK中的tools绝对路径(本机为D:AndroidDevelopandroid-sdk-windows ools)。
    image_thumb.png
    “确定”后,重新启动计算机。重启计算机以后,进入cmd命令窗口,检查SDK是不是安装成功。
    运行 android –h 如果有类似以下的输出,表明安装成功:
    image_thumb_1.png


    • 打开 Eclipse IDE,进入菜单中的 "Help" -> "Install New Software"
    • 点击Add...按钮,弹出对话框要求输入Name和Location:Name自己随便取,Location输入https://dl-ssl.google.com/android/eclipse。如下图所示:
    image_thumb_4.png


    • 确定返回后,在work with后的下拉列表中选择我们刚才添加的ADT,我们会看到下面出有Developer Tools,展开它会有Android DDMS和Android Development Tool,勾选他们。 如下图所示:
    image_thumb_6.png


    • 然后就是按提示一步一步next。
    完成之后:


    • 选择Window > Preferences...
    • 在左边的面板选择Android,然后在右侧点击Browse...并选中SDK路径,本机为:
      D:AndroidDevelopandroid-sdk-windows
    • 点击Apply、OK。配置完成。

    3、软件配置
    为使Android应用程序可以在模拟器上运行,必须创建AVD。


    • 1、在Eclipse中。选择Windows > Android SDK and AVD Manager
    • 2、点击左侧面板的Virtual Devices,再右侧点击New
    • 3、填入Name,选择Target的API,SD Card大小任意,Skin随便选,Hardware目前保持默认值
    • 4、点击Create AVD即可完成创建AVD
    注意:如果你点击左侧面板的Virtual Devices,再右侧点击New ,而target下拉列表没有可选项时,这时候你:
    image_thumb_7.png





      • 然后点击Install Selected按钮,接下来就是按提示做就行了
    要做这两步,原因是在Android SDK安装中没有安装一些必要的可用包(Available Packages)。
    4、运行Hello World


    • 通过File -> New -> Project 菜单,建立新项目"Android Project"
    • 然后填写必要的参数,如下图所示:(注意这里我勾选的是Google APIs,你可以选你喜欢的,但你要创建相应的AVD)
    image_thumb_5.png
    相关参数的说明:


    • Project Name: 包含这个项目的文件夹的名称。
    • Package Name: 包名,遵循JAVA规范,用包名来区分不同的类是很重要的,我用的是helloworld.test。
    • Activity Name: 这是项目的主类名,这个类将会是Android的Activity类的子类。一个Activity类是一个简单的启动程序和控制程序的类。它可以根据需要创建界面,但不是必须的。
    • Application Name: 一个易读的标题在你的应用程序上。
    • 在"选择栏"的 "Use default location" 选项,允许你选择一个已存在的项目。


    • 点击Finish后,点击Eclipse的Run菜单选择Run Configurations…
    • 选择“Android Application”,点击在左上角(按钮像一张纸上有个“+”号)或者双击“Android Application”, 有个新的选项“New_configuration”(可以改为我们喜欢的名字)。
    • 在右侧Android面板中点击Browse…,选择HelloWorld
    • 在Target面板的Automatic中勾选相应的AVD,如果没有可用的AVD的话,你需要点击右下角的Manager…,然后新建相应的AVD。如下图所示:
    image_thumb_8.png


    • 然后点Run按钮即可,运行成功的话会有Android的模拟器界面,如下图所示:
                   
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    奋斗
    2022-3-17 14:44
  • 签到天数: 238 天

    [LV.7]常住居民III

    发表于 2011-10-30 08:36:22 | 显示全部楼层
    做个记号,以后再看


    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2023-6-19 09:56
  • 签到天数: 613 天

    [LV.9]以坛为家II

    发表于 2011-11-9 12:46:00 | 显示全部楼层
    Eclipse和MyEclipse有什么区别吗??????????
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2024-1-17 06:45
  • 签到天数: 306 天

    [LV.8]以坛为家I

    发表于 2011-12-25 09:51:45 | 显示全部楼层
    Eclipse和MyEclipse有什么区别吗??????????
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2021-8-30 00:00
  • 签到天数: 35 天

    [LV.5]常住居民I

     楼主| 发表于 2012-3-5 19:03:50 | 显示全部楼层
    MyEclipse 8.5注册码

    name:myeclipse8.5
    code:zLR8ZC-855550-68567156703100078
    name:52accptech
    code:0LR8ZC-855550-68567157524981450
    name:bingchuan
    codeLR8ZC-855550-68567157669572882

    把注册码贴到Window-->preferences-->myeclipse-->subscription里。


    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2024-4-16 15:31
  • 签到天数: 2207 天

    [LV.Master]伴坛终老

    发表于 2012-3-8 17:56:08 | 显示全部楼层
    正打算学一下这个,先来了解一下
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    奋斗
    13 小时前
  • 签到天数: 3731 天

    [LV.Master]伴坛终老

    发表于 2012-4-20 19:20:05 | 显示全部楼层
    不会JAVA啊,不过还是要支持一下呢
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2017-11-15 16:08
  • 签到天数: 82 天

    [LV.6]常住居民II

    发表于 2012-5-1 12:57:18 | 显示全部楼层
    好东东,一定要支持,收藏备用此贴必火,先占位支持了,谢谢分享
    启用邀请码注册,提高发帖质量,建设交流社区
  • TA的每日心情
    开心
    2017-11-15 16:08
  • 签到天数: 82 天

    [LV.6]常住居民II

    发表于 2012-5-1 12:57:42 | 显示全部楼层
    真是是很不错,很值得收藏啊......
    好东东,一定要支持,收藏备用此贴必火,先占位支持了,谢谢分享
    启用邀请码注册,提高发帖质量,建设交流社区
    您需要登录后才可以回帖 登录 | 注册

    本版积分规则

    快速回复 返回顶部 返回列表